-官方认证诚信至上 | 工业机器人及工控系统领军企业
今日科普|MATLAB工控系统仿真
发布时间:
2025-08-21 04:02:23
来源:
浏览量:314
### MATLAB工控系统仿真在工业控制领域,MATLAB作为一款功能强大的数学计算和仿真软件,发挥着举足轻重的作用。它不仅能够帮助工程师们高效地进行系统设计和优化,还能显著降低研发成本,缩短产品上市时间。本文将深入探讨MATLAB在工控系统仿真中的应用,带你了解这一技术的魅力所在。
MATLAB在工控系统中的基(jī)础(chǔ)应(yīng)用(yòng)
MATLAB,全称(chēng)为(wèi)Matrix Laboratory,由(yóu)美(měi)国(guó)MathWorks公(gōng)司(sī)开(kāi)发(fā),是(shì)一(yī)款(kuǎn)广(guǎng)泛(fàn)应(yīng)用(yòng)于(yú)工(gōng)程(chéng)计(jì)算(suàn)、控(kòng)制(zhì)设(shè)计(jì)、信(xìn)号处理等多个领域的数值计算和可视化编程环境。在工控系统中,MATLAB主要用于系统建模、仿真分析和控制策略测试。据统计,使用MATLAB进行仿真可以比传统方🍆法提高30%以上的设计效率,同时降低20%左右的成本。这得益于MATLAB强大的计算能力和丰富的工具箱支持,如控制系统工具箱(Control System Toolbox)和Simulink等。

MATLAB仿真平台的搭建与操作
要利用MATLAB进行工控系统仿真,首先需要搭建一个合适的仿真环境。这包括安装MATLAB软件、配置必要的工具箱和插件,以及设置相(xiāng)关的(de)仿(fǎng)真(zhēn)参数。对于初学者来说,MATLAB的安装和配置过程相对简单,只需访问MathWorks官网下载最新版的安装包,并🚁按照提示进行安装即可。在搭建好仿真环境后,工程师们可以利用MATLAB提供的丰富函数库和工具箱,如tf函数创建传递函数模型、ss函数创建状态空间模型等,进行系统建模和仿真分析。值得一提的是,MATLAB还支持并行计算,可以加速仿真过程,进一步提高设计效率。
MATLAB在工控系统仿真中的高级应用
除了基础的系统建模和仿真分析外,MATLAB在工控系统仿真中还有许多高级应用。例如,利用MATLAB可(kě)以(yǐ)设计和优化复杂的控制算法,如模糊逻🏀辑控制、神经网络控制等。这些高级算法对于提高工控系统的性能至关重要。以永磁同步风力发电机的控制为例,工程师们可以利用MATLAB仿真模型,探究最优叶尖速比控制和基于PI控制器的双闭环控制策略。通过仿真分析,可以精确计算出在不同风速下风力机的理想转速,并验证控制策略的有效性。此外,MATLAB还支持实时仿真技术,可以模拟实际工况下的系统响应,为设计和优化控制系统提供有力支持。据最新研究显示,利用MATLAB进行实时仿真可以显著提高工控系统的稳定性和鲁棒性。
综上所述,MATLAB在工控系统仿真中发挥着不可替代的作用。它不仅提供了强大的计算能力和丰富的工具箱支持,还🆙支持并行计算和实时仿真技术,为工程师们提供了高效、准确、可靠的仿真平台。随着工业4.0和智能制造的不断发展,MATLAB在工控系统仿真中的应用前景将更加广阔。作为工程师们手中的得力助手,MATLAB将继续助力工控系统的创新与发展。